Has anyone replaced the 12 volt motor/pump on the HWH Series 610? The positive post has become loose and is sparking when energized. First thought was that I had a loose cable but no such luck. If I try to remove the nut, I am afraid the post will twist off. If anyone has replace one is there anything I should know before I start?

Usually those motors are a lot like a 12 volt starter motor. If you take the unit off I would find a alternator/starter rebuild shop in your area and take it in and let them see if they can fix it.

Update; Getting ready to travel and you know how it goes, you always wait for the last minute to get things fixed. Anyway HWH has the pump for $260 plus shipping. Sounds like it won't be that hard to replace. I won't even have to drain the reservoir.
